The first East Charlotte Tractor Parade was held on October 14, 2001. The humble beginnings of 20 tractors and 100 spectators have grown into an annual Fall Festival that signals the end of the harvest season, celebrates the farming tradition, and provides the opportunity for the community to share their love of tractors, both old and new.
The parade now attracts more than 200 tractors from all points of Vermont with some being ferried across Lake Champlain from New York. The day also includes local music, farmers market, animals, rope making, free games for children, a toy tractor display and much more.
